Melville is a well-established residential and commercial community in the Town of Huntington, known for its larger colonials and custom homes from the 1970s through the 1990s. These are substantial properties that often have more complex plumbing configurations — multiple bathrooms, larger water heater setups, multi-zone boiler systems, and in many cases, features like recirculation systems or whole-house water treatment.
Water heater service in Melville often involves larger-capacity units. Multi-bathroom colonials typically need 50 to 75-gallon tanks, or in the case of homes with high simultaneous demand, a tankless system that eliminates the capacity issue entirely. We install Bradford White tank units and Navien tankless systems, and we can walk you through the real differences in cost and performance rather than defaulting to whichever option has the better margin.
Boiler service is another regular part of our Melville work. Multi-zone hot water systems in larger homes need annual attention to stay running efficiently. A boiler that has been skipping annual tune-ups will eventually have a mid-winter emergency, and in a large home, that is a significant problem. We take pre-season tune-ups seriously and tell you honestly when equipment is approaching the end of its service life.

Job 1: Tankless water heater installation, Melville. Large colonial with two aging 50-gallon gas water heaters in series — one failed and the owner did not want to replace in kind. Installed a Navien NPE-240A2 condensing unit that handles the full house demand from one unit. Freed up significant space in the utility room.
Job 2: Boiler service — multi-zone system, Melville. Annual tune-up on a three-zone gas hot water boiler in a 1985 colonial. Cleaned the burner, tested all zone valves, checked the expansion tank pressure, bled the radiators and baseboard loops. Found the circulator pump on zone two was making noise — bearing was going. Replaced the pump.
Job 3: Sewer camera inspection and cleanout, Melville. Customer had recurring main line slow-downs. Camera confirmed root intrusion at a cleanout tee connection on the lateral. Cleared roots and repaired the cleanout cover which was cracked and allowing root ingress. No further backups in six months.
Job 4: Water softener and whole-house filtration, Melville. Customer on a private well had hard water and taste concerns. Installed a whole-house sediment filter, water softener, and under-sink reverse osmosis system for the kitchen. Customer noticed the change in water quality immediately.
Job 5: Recirculation system installation, Melville. Large home — master bath was over 60 feet from the water heater. Customer was wasting significant water waiting for hot to arrive. Installed a Grundfos comfort recirculation pump and a bypass valve under the far bathroom vanity. Hot water now within 20 seconds.
Job 6: Frozen pipe repair, Melville. Burst copper supply line in an exterior garage wall — January cold snap had frozen the pipe where it ran without insulation before entering the garage. Repaired the break, moved the pipe run to an interior wall, and properly insulated the penetration.
Job 7: Toilet replacement — master bath, Melville. Customer had a top-of-the-line toilet that was 18 years old and the fill mechanism had failed for the second time. Replaced the unit entirely with a new comfort-height two-piece elongated unit. Proper flushing performance, no more running.
Job 8: Gas appliance line and shut-off, Melville. Customer was adding a gas fireplace insert and needed a new gas line run and shut-off valve from the nearest existing gas supply. Ran 1/2" gas line from the basement manifold through the wall to the fireplace location. Installed a dedicated ball valve shut-off and pressure-tested before the fireplace installer connected.
